Abstract
Polyblends comprising about 10 to about 90% by weight of polyphenylene oxide and about 90 to about 10% of SAN or ABS polymer comprising 8 to 17 average % by weight acrylonitrile in which the acrylonitrile compositional distribution in the SAN or ABS polymer is broad in that the standard deviation of the weight % AN about the mean value is at least about 3.5%.
